Ubisoft Lays Off 19 Employees In Red Storm Due To “Ongoing, Targeted Restructuring”
It isn't clear f Red Storm has any original projects currently in development.

It isn't clear f Red Storm has any original projects currently in development.

We are really hoping we are nearing the end of this cycle.

It's been six months since we at GameRanx have reported on this game.

Is the game going to make it to its 2023 deadline?

In general, expect streamlined systems, but also really difficult gameplay.

This virtual reality based Whodunit? game is full of werewolves and intrigue.
